Output 39c8b2ce32bc34d3c519ded30a66829da3e6bb1a6e752362692f0c963adfb445:40

value
15854023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ba3df33d0522ad2c682a470491c02f91d2268f7 OP_EQUAL
address
MLdWU7VYzUypJ6zWeQ1zFGosSjPfGmsURi
transaction
39c8b2ce32bc34d3c519ded30a66829da3e6bb1a6e752362692f0c963adfb445
spent
true